In Mumbai's Bandra area, a 31-year-old man named Chirag Hargunani was apprehended by police for allegedly kidnapping an individual and demanding sexual favors. Hargunani, who was reportedly inebriated, was driving a luxury Audi when he approached two men on a motorcycle, seeking directions to a park.

He then persuaded one of the men, Mohammad Taabish Shoeb Kutty, to enter his car to help him navigate. However, Hargunani proceeded to abduct Kutty and subsequently made unwelcome sexual advances. When Kutty resisted and requested to be released, Hargunani subjected him to an assault.

Kutty, in a desperate act, managed to remove the car keys, bringing the vehicle to a halt. This enabled his escape and subsequent reporting of the crime to the authorities. Hargunani was arrested by the Bandra police under relevant sections of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ita for kidnapping and other offenses.
